Du übernimmst die Entwicklung und Weiterentwicklung komplexer Backend
und Frontend-Komponenten – auf Basis von Java (Spring Boot) und TypeScript (Vue.js).
Du gestaltest die Architektur unserer Plattform aktiv mit – modular, skalierbar und wartbar.
Du verantwortest ganze Funktionsbereiche, vom ersten Architekturentwurf bis zum produktiven Betrieb.
Du treibst Refactoring-Maßnahmen an, entwirfst Migrationen und verbesserst bestehende Module konsequent weiter.
Du gestaltest unsere Entwicklungsprozesse mit – durch automatisierte Tests, saubere CI/CD-Pipelines, sinnvolle Code-Reviews und Tools, die wirklich helfen.
Du arbeitest eng mit UX, Product und DevOps zusammen – immer mit Blick auf das beste Gesamtergebnis.
Requirements
Mehrjährige Erfahrung als Software Engineer , idealerweise in komplexen Webanwendungen.
Sehr gute Kenntnisse in Java mit Spring Boot und TypeScript mit Vue.js .
Erfahrung mit MongoDB, Docker, HTML/CSS sowie CI/CD -Prozessen.
Tiefes technisches Verständnis – du denkst in Systemen, nicht nur in Komponenten.
Hohes Qualitätsbewusstsein, Eigenverantwortung und der Wille, Dinge wirklich gut zu machen.
Gute Deutschkenntnisse, solide Englisch-Skills.
Tech Stack
Docker
Java
JavaScript
MongoDB
Spring
Spring Boot
SpringBoot
TypeScript
Vue.js
Benefits
Technologische Gestaltungsfreiheit: Deine Erfahrung zählt – wir entscheiden gemeinsam im Team.
Klare Strukturen ohne Bürokratie: Agiles Arbeiten ohne Scrum-Theater.
Ein starkes Team: Kolleg:innen, die Verantwortung übernehmen und Know-how teilen.
Hybrides Arbeiten: Zwischen Office und Home – mit voller Flexibilität.
Top-Ausstattung: MacBook Pro, IDEs nach Wahl, moderne Tools.
30 Urlaubstage + faire Vergütung
Regelmäßige Team-Events & echtes Miteinander – keine Pflichtveranstaltungen, sondern echtes Interesse.